In the pantheon of early 2010s Bollywood cinema, few films capture the curious intersection of romantic melodrama, hyper-masculine heroism, and the anxieties of modern surveillance quite like Bodyguard (2011). Directed by Siddique (remaking his own 2010 Malayalam film), starring Salman Khan in his characteristic larger-than-life avatar, Bodyguard achieved colossal box-office success, yet it remains a film of fascinating contradictions. On the surface, it is a simple love story between a wealthy heiress, Divya (Kareena Kapoor), and her fiercely loyal bodyguard, Lovely Singh (Salman Khan). Beneath its populist veneer, however, Bodyguard offers a rich terrain for exploring themes of performative masculinity, the ethics of protective surveillance, the role of technology in intimacy, and the tension between professional duty and personal desire. This essay will argue that Bodyguard is not merely a star vehicle but a cultural text that reflects deep-seated Indian anxieties about female autonomy, male possessiveness disguised as care, and the ultimate failure of physical protection in the face of emotional truth. index of bodyguard 2011 new

Bodyguard (2011) is far more than a disposable action-romance. It is a cultural document that interrogates the relationship between love and surveillance, protection and possession. The film’s central failure—that Lovely’s protection is ultimately irrelevant to Divya’s safety (she is never truly in danger except from the very system designed to protect her)—is also its deepest insight.
